Govt plans to nudge auto industry to invest in a rare-earth-magnet-free future
Hindustan Times Noida
|November 04, 2025
The government plans to nudge the automobile industry to invest in research and development (R&D) of rare-earth-magnet-free technology, according to two officials aware of the plan, as the country seeks to break free from China's stranglehold and adopt cleaner solutions.
The Union heavy industries ministry plans to leverage funds from the government's ₹50,000 crore Anusandhan National Research Foundation (ANRF) towards this strategic push to counter China, which remains a dominant force controlling more than 90% of the world’s rare earth processing capabilities, said one of the two officials quoted earlier.
